Перейти к содержимому

User Feedback MCP

Обеспечивает взаимодействие с пользователем в workflow для тестирования desktop-приложений в инструментах вроде Cline и Cursor.

Python
47 stars

Описание

Это простой сервер для human-in-the-loop workflow, интегрируемый в Cline и Cursor. Позволяет запрашивать отзыв пользователя перед завершением задач, особенно полезно для desktop-приложений с сложными взаимодействиями. Поддерживает конфигурацию команд в .user-feedback.json, автоматическое выполнение и тестирование через веб-интерфейс. Технологии: Python, uv, fastmcp. Применения: разработка и тестирование UI с пользовательским фидбеком.

Возможности

Запрос пользовательского фидбека

Использует инструмент user_feedback для получения отзыва перед завершением задачи.

Конфигурация команд

Создает .user-feedback.json для настройки команд, таких как npm run dev, с опцией автоматического выполнения.

Тестирование в разработке

Запуск dev-режима с веб-интерфейсом на localhost:5173 для взаимодействия с MCP-инструментами.

Интеграция в prompt

Добавление инструкции в custom prompt для автоматического запроса фидбека в Cline.

Установка

{ “mcpServers”: { “github.com/mrexodia/user-feedback-mcp”: { “command”: “uv”, “args”: [ “–directory”, “c:\MCP\user-feedback-mcp”, “run”, “server.py” ], “timeout”: 600, “autoApprove”: [ “user_feedback” ] } } }

Установка uv: Windows - pip install uv; Linux/Mac - curl -LsSf https://astral.sh/uv/install.sh | sh. Клонировать репозиторий и добавить конфиг в cline_mcp_settings.json.

Информация

Язык
Python
Лицензия
MIT License
GitHub Stars
47

Ссылки